Ministry of Women and Child Development invites applications for paid internship

The Ministry of Women and Child Development is accepting applications from women students, scholars, social activists and teachers from non-Tier-1 cities as part of its internship programme. Its objective is to translate the Hon’ble Prime Minister’s idea of building self-reliant India.

Through this initiative, the Ministry aims to tap the talent of interns and give them the opportunity to work for the implementation of schemes as well as deliberate upon its policies through different assignments. The duration of the internship will be one month and two months separately throughout the year. An intern can choose any one duration out of the two while submitting their applications.

Further, the Ministry would take up to 10 interns per batch. Interested candidates should be enrolled or associated with any university, academic or a non-academic institution. To submit the applications online, log onto the official website — wcd.intern.nic.in
